Proteomics
Proteomics is the large-scale study of proteins .Proteins are vital parts of living organisms, with many functions. The proteome is the entire set of proteins that is produced or modified by an organism or system. Proteins are often used specifically to refer to protein purification and mass spectrometry. Proteomics has enabled the identification of ever increasing numbers of protein. Proteomics is an interdisciplinary domain that has benefitted greatly from the genetic information of various genome projects. proteomics is the study of biological systems. Proteins themselves are macromolecules, long chains of amino acids. This amino acid chain is constructed when the cellular machinery of the ribosome translates RNA transcripts from DNA in the cell's nucleus. The transfer of information within cells commonly follows this path, from DNA to RNA to protein.
